The Fuzzies were born in 2003 as a collection of currently available dogs that appealed to me as I looked through various rescue and shelter web sites. My hope was that friends would consider a rescue or shelter dog for the next addition to their families once they saw how many adorable ones were out there.
Kim's Fuzzies has grown quite a bit since then but the goal is still the same. I want to present that there are other places to adopt new family members than backyard breeders, puppy mills and pet stores (Please note that I support the aspirations of legitimate breeders to better their breeds without an eye towards pimping their dogs for money). I want to show people that their images of shelter and rescue dogs may be wrong - there are stunning dogs that end up in shelters and move to rescue every day. There are also, unfortunately, stunning and adoptable dogs that get euthanized every day because there are never enough rescues to help solve the problem. Awareness is everything.
Please do not assume that, if you see a dog you like and then they aren't on the next list that they have been adopted. I rotate the fuzzies I include to give the best exposure to a greater number of potential adoptees. Always call the shelter or rescue and ask the status of any dog you find yourself drawn to.
Additionally, if you are drawn to an animal but aren't sure you're ready for the lifelong commitment, please consider fostering (a temporary arrangement that pulls them from the danger of euthanization to live with you for a short time until they find the perfect forever family). It is so incredibly rewarding and addictive. Let me know if you need information about how to do this and I'll hook you up.

My name is Kim Smith and I'm just a person who happens to really love animals. With The Fuzzies, I am trying to do my small part to help out in the world. I currently live with a 3 year old golden (Borrego), a 10 year old grey tabby (Shadow), a 4 year old black tom cat (Tobee) and a tank full of guppies. I foster for multiple rescues as they need me (mostly puppies cuz my Borrego loves puppies), do web work as asked, am the Secretary for the Board of Pit Bull Rescue San Diego, as well as keeping up on Borrego's training and staying current my own animal education. If I don't know the answer to someone's question, I WILL find it out. Oh yeah - I have a full time job outside of the animal world as well.
I started looking through all the rescue and shelter sites when I was looking to adopt my golden a couple of years ago. I was surprised at how many resources there are beyond breeders and pet stores, and I enjoyed looking through the sites and reading the stories.
Unfortunately I had a very bad experience with the rescue organization that I tried to adopt through - they actually told me that I was being irresponsible considering dog ownership since I work full time and there was no way they would consider placing a dog with me. I got furious and irrational and ended up adopting my Borrego from a disreputable back yard breeder to "show them". Don't get me wrong, I love my Borrego to death but, health-wise, she is every argument against backyard breeders. She is highly neurotic, had to have both hips replaced before she was one year old, is allergic to most foods as well as many airborne allergens... In retrospect and calmer emotions, I realized that I had become a part of the problem, not the solution. I started to research rescue organizations that really did have the animals best interests rather than their own egos at stake. Kim's Fuzzies were borne of this research and I started emailing them to friends and family. As the word spread, the Fuzzies has grown to a subscribership of over 200 (free and no obligation) and I get emails and calls from shelters, rescues and private folks for help with whatever level of connection they need. I love it and feel like my little part really is making a difference in some canine lives!
